Summary: "A shocking murder leaves an affluent retirement community reeling in this riveting high-stakes thriller. Death is not an unfamiliar visitor to Shady Oaks Retirement Village, which provides San Diego's premier elderly support from independent retiree housing to full-time hospice care. But when a resident's body is found brutally stabbed and his apartment ransacked, it's clear there's someone deadly in their community. Detective Katherine "Kit" McKittrick quickly discovers that Shady Oaks is full of skeleton-riddled closets, and most tenants prefer to keep their doors firmly closed to the SDPD. A longtime volunteer at the retirement facility, Dr. Sam Reeves honors his late grandfather's memory by playing the piano for the residents regularly. So it shouldn't be such a surprise when Kit crosses paths with him during her investigation, after she'd avoided the criminal psychologist - and the emotions he evokes - for the last six months. Sam's rapport within the retirement village proves vital to the case, and the pair find themselves working together once again - much to Kit's dismay. But she is determined to apprehend the shadow of death lurking around Shady Oaks...and equally determined to ignore the feelings she's developing for a certain psychologist"--
